SWPPP NARRATIVE (MR #2) <br />The intent of this section is to provide the information necessary to support the <br />engineering plans to implement a design that will; reduce, eliminate or prevent the <br />discharge of stormwater pollutants, meet or exceed the water quality and sediment <br />management standards for the City and State, and prevent adverse impacts to the <br />receiving waters for this project. Note; this narrative is intended to support the SWPPP <br />that is included with the Targeted Drainage Plans also a part of this submittal package <br />to the City. <br />A. SITE GRADING/EROSION CONTROL RISK ASSESSMENT <br />Area proposed to be cleared/worked <br />Average slope for the short plat: <br />Erosion Hazard of Soil <br />Critical Areas downslope <br />Site is upstream of an ESA Stream <br />1.23 acres <br />5% (Area of Disturbance Only) <br />Low <br />No <br />No <br />Based on the above information and the fact that the area of the short plat to be <br />disturbed is flat and construction site runoff will pass through silt fencing or other <br />perimeter filtration features prior to leaving the short plat, and that if site conditions <br />warrant, additional BMP's can be implemented as corrective measures the Risk <br />Category for this site is Low Risk. <br />B. SWPPP MINIMUM ELEMENTS <br />1: Preserve Vegetation and Mark Clearing Limits <br />The first step in the construction process is for the contractor to fence the limits of <br />clearing/disturbance (BMP C103) prior to any other construction activity. The <br />engineering plans locate and provide the square footages for the areas of grading, <br />clearing, impervious surfaces and un-disturbed areas on the proposed short plat. The <br />entire project area will be cleared or disturbed for this project. <br />2: Establish Construction Access <br />The SWPPP calls for the proposed construction entrance (BMP C105) to be installed <br />as the second step after the staking of clearing limits. The construction entrance for <br />this project will be constructed on -site off of 124'h St SE. At this time winter work is <br />expected during the wet season. <br />3: Control Flow Rates <br />This project is below the thresholds requiring flow control for the project. <br />Perez SP <br />March 2022 <br />Revised: June/August 2022 Page 7 <br />
